The Role of Artificial Intelligence in Advancing the Smart Appliances Market
The global landscape of domestic chores is undergoing a radical transformation as connected devices transition from luxury novelties into essential household infrastructure. Driven by rapid advancements in the Internet of Things (IoT) and artificial intelligence, modern consumers are increasingly seeking out automated solutions that offer both convenience and resource efficiency. Washing machines that optimize detergent usage based on fabric weight, refrigerators that monitor expiration dates, and robotic vacuums that map floor plans autonomously are no longer concepts of science fiction. This shift is deeply rooted in the changing lifestyle dynamics of urban populations, where time-poverty has become a significant driver for technology adoption. As smart home ecosystems become more integrated and interoperable, the demand for appliances that communicate seamlessly with one another is escalating, paving the way for unprecedented growth across the entire home automation sector.
Looking ahead, the trajectory of this industry points toward an era of predictive automation and enhanced energy management, particularly as sustainability becomes a core consumer priority. Future developments are expected to focus heavily on integrating smart grids with household devices, allowing appliances to operate during off-peak hours to minimize electricity costs and reduce carbon footprints. Furthermore, the incorporation of voice-activation and advanced machine-learning algorithms will enable these devices to anticipate user preferences rather than just reacting to explicit commands. As manufacturers invest heavily in research and development, we can expect a significant reduction in production costs, making these advanced technologies accessible to a broader demographic worldwide. Frequently Asked Questions
-
What defines an appliance as "smart" compared to a traditional one? A smart appliance features internet connectivity, built-in sensors, and processing power that allow it to be monitored, controlled remotely, and optimized automatically via a smartphone or central home hub.
-
How do connected appliances contribute to energy efficiency? They track resource consumption in real-time, optimize operational cycles based on usage patterns, and can delay heavy energy tasks to off-peak hours when electricity rates are lower.
